Solid Disc Holder
I have ordered several of these cases in the past to hold old DVDs. It is a great way to reduce box clutter & Shelf space. It's also fantastic in case you need to move.Case is solid and is holding up well to being almost entirely full. I've had cheaper brands start cracking & ripping when full.My only complaint is about the sleeve holder itself. Older versions I own have s metal ring to hold the sleeves and it opens from the middle. That means you can turn to any sleeve & add more, empty ones or switch things around easily. This style (plastic arm to hold sleeves) can only be opened from the front of all the pages meaning you have to remove all the pages from the front to add or move others around. Minor complaint but annoying

I have a lot of CDs and wanted to get rid of the jewel cases to reclaim some space in my living room. I read a lot of reviews before buying this case, and here is what made me choose it.PROS* Space for a lot of CDs (208 in the pages, 16 more up front) but not so many that it's a pain to carry.* CDs are inserted from the top, *not the side*. This is huge because otherwise all the CDs would shake loose when carrying the case by it's handle.* The handle is a definite plus for a case this size when more than half filled.* Despite what manufacturer says, you *can* fit both the CD booklet and the CD into each pocket. Have not filled all the pockets yet, but have done so with another similar CaseLogic case. Some reviewers said that the pages filled with booklets and CDs will exceed the capacity of the binder. Again, have not filled this one to capacity yet but did not have this problem with the other similar case. Case Logic CD-R ProSleeve® Binder - 192 Discs* Exterior is nice-looking black faux leather, smooth so easy to clean.CONS* Like every other CD wallet, the zipper comes nearly all the way to the edge but leaves a gap for dust to get in. I get that this is pretty unavoidable, but why not put the gap on the bottom rather than the top. That way no dust would get in, and way too small a gap to lose a CD.OTHER* The "binder" does allow pages to be pulled in and out for rearranging but I don't really plan to make use of that. Some people don't like that it only opens in front (so that all pages in front of the one that you want to remove must also be removed), but hardly a concern because I'm not going to be doing this several times per day.* Some people complained that the binder is a little flimsy. Have not had problems with it but have not really stress tested it yet either.
